21 CFR §872.3900

- (a)Identification. A posterior artificial tooth with a metal insert is a porcelain device with an insert made of austenitic alloys or alloys containing 75 percent or greater gold and metals of the platinum group intended to replace a natural tooth. The device is attached to surrounding teeth by a bridge and is intended to provide both an improvement in appearance and functional occlusion (bite).
- (b)Classification. Class I (general controls). The device is exempt from the premarket notification procedures in subpart E of part 807 of this chapter subject to the limitations in § 872.9.
